Transaction 3e28041a17a1fa9bd5bf600c093f747c596c178e08216c41e9863a56804ca0fe
1 Input
1 Output
-
3e28041a17a1fa9bd5bf600c093f747c596c178e08216c41e9863a56804ca0fe:0
- value
- 309985
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f93c56a4ba981c1784a490f50cca43e13f8b743
- address
- bc1qe7fu26jt4xquz7z2fy84pn9y8cfl3d6rzy6ark